Calabria present with two films at the 78th edition of the Locarno Festival: “I don’t leave you alone”, of
Fabrizio Cattani, scheduled for today, August 9, included in the “Locarno Kids” section of the Festival, e
“The Gospel of Judas”, directed by Giulio Base, which will be projected on 11 August out of competition in the
Swiss event.
Another important showcase for cinema supported by Calabria Film Commission and shot on ours
territory, with the promotion of places and the use of Calabrian workers, 106, overall in
Two movies.
The two screenings will be present the Calabria Film Commission Foundation with President Anton
Giulio Grande.
“The Gospel of Judas” produced by Agnus dei Production, Minerva Pictures and Rai Cinema, in co -production
With Agresywna Banda, he was shot for four weeks in the territories of the municipalities of Curinga (Platano
Millennial), Corigliano – Rossano (Abbey of the patire), Cleto (Castello Cleto, Castello Savuto, Fiume
Savuto), Sila National Park (Lago Cecita), Caccuri (Grancia del Vurdoj, cave caves Caccuri),
Mendicino (Monte Cocuzzo), Cosenza (Castello Svevo, historic center). 71 Calabrian professionals involved
in filming.
The cast is made up of internationally renowned interpreters such as Giancarlo Giannini, Rupert Everett, Tomasz
Kot, Paz Vega, Abel Ferrara, Vincenzo Galluzzo, Ada Roncone and with Darko Peric and John Savage.
“I do not leave you alone”, however, the new film by Fabrizio Cattani (Materity Blues, chronicle of a passion),
Based on the novel of the same name by Gianluca Antoni published by Salani, it is produced by Gianluca Curti, Emanuele
Nespeca, Elisabetta Olmi and Tilde Corsi, the editing is by Paola Freddi and the soundtrack of Luca
D’Alberto. It is an exciting and passionate film, able to play on the edge of different genres:
Like a modern fairy tale, history takes place in an pressing and unexpected way, dyeing what it seems like a
Classic Coming-Of-Aage of the fascinating colors of noir.
The filming of “I do not leave you alone” took place for 4 weeks in Calabria between Camigliatello Silano and
Municipalities of Spezzano, Celico, San Giovani in Fiore, Rende, Castrolibero and Cosenza. Production is by
Minerva Pictures, Solaria Film, Hypothesis Cinema and RC Production. 35 units worked in the crew
Calabresi out of 50 who composed the team that worked in the area.
